Device comprises: (a) a bottom slide rail (3) with a cutting slide for a lower section at a structured surface and an upper slide rail (5) with a cutting slide for an upper section at normal surface, where both slide rails are in an acute angle and are arranged obliquely with respect to the sliding direction of a glass ribbon (11) and the inclination is adjustable; (b) a number of back pressure rollers (8) for the lower cutting slide (4); (c) a suppression with a crushing roller and a front suppression roller for the lower section; (d) a suppression with a crushing roller and a back suppression roller for the upper section; and (e) device for measuring the pre-running speed of the glass ribbon and its actual length. Independent claims are also included for: (1) cutting a float glass ribbon with normal or structured surface, comprising providing a plant for producing normal float glass or float glass with a structured surface, which includes the bottom slide rail with cutting slide for lower section at a structured surface and an upper slide rail with the cutting slide for the upper section at normal surface, providing the components (b), (c), (d), and (e), detecting the structure of the surface of the cut ends of float glass ribbon by sensors, crushing a suppression with a crushing roller and a back suppression roller in the presence of unstructured glass at the desired point of the float glass ribbon, and crushing the suppression with the crushing roller and a suppression roller in the presence of structured glass at the desired point of the float glass ribbon; (2) a computer program having a program code for carrying out the above mentioned method, when the program is performed in a computer; and (3) a machine readable carrier with the program code of the computer program for carrying out the above mentioned method, when the program is performed in a computer. |
